A few Things That You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ster
Although the specific rules that regulate what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of substances that most trash dumpster rental prices service in Denvers will not let. A number of the things that you commonly cannot set in the dumpster comprise:
Batteries, especially the kind that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other compounds that may damage the environment) Electronics, especially the ones that feature batteries There are also some mattresses you could generally set in your dumpster as long as you are willing to pay an added f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ental business to get a list of stuff that you just can't put into the dumpster.
Deciding Where to Place Your Dumpster
Deciding where to put your dumpster can have a big impact regarding how quickly you finish endeavors. The most effective alternative is to select a location that is near the worksite. It's important, however, to contemplate whether this location is a safe choice. Make sure the place is free of barriers that could trip individuals while they carry heavy debris.
A lot of individuals decide to place dumpsters in their drives. This is really a convenient choice since it generally means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In case you have to place the dumpster on the road, then you definitely need to contact your local government to inquire whether you are required to get a permit. Although many munic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for brief amounts of time, others will request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ules will help you avoid fines which will make your job more expensive.

Depending on the size of your project, you may require a small or big dumpster that can hold all of the debris and remaining stuff.
Dumpster rental companies typically provide several sizes for individuals and companies. Deciding on the best size should allow you to remove debris as affordably as possible.
The most common dumpsters comprise 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. For those who have a little project, including cl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ely benefit from a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. For those who have a larger project, including a complete remodel or building a brand new home, then you'll lik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.
Many folks choose to rent a larger dumpster than they think they are going to want. Although renting a larger dumpster costs more cash, it is more economical than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ets complete.

When will my dumpster get picked up?
You are going to typically schedule the period of time you intend to maintain the dumpster when you first call to set up your dumpster service. This usually includes the drop off and pick up dates. Most companies do ask that you be present when the dumpster is delivered. This really is essential to make sure the dumpster is put in the very best place for your project. You don't have to be present when the dumpster is picked up to haul it away.
If you get into your project and recognize you need pick up sooner or later than you originally requested, that is no issue. Just call the business's office and explain what you require, and they will do everything they can to accommodate your request. There might be times they can't match your adjusted schedule exactly because of previous obligations, nevertheless they will do the best they are able to in order to pick your dumpster upward at the right time.
What is the biggest size dumpster available?
The biggest roll off dumpster that firms generally r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be really aware of the limitation and do your best not to transcend it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up quickly.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will probably be the ideal size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of junk when you are mo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ts

Do I require a permit to rent a dumpster in Denver?
If that is your very first time renting a dumpster in Denver, you may not understand what's leg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. Should you plan to place the dumpster totally on your own property, you are not commonly required to obtain a permit.
If, nevertheless, your job needs you to put the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will generally mean that you must try to qualify for a permit. It's almost always advisable to check with your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ement department) if you own a question concerning the demand for a permit on a road.
If you fail to obtain a permit and find out afterwards that you were required to have one, you may likely face a fine from your local authorities.
